GoldenAgri

S/4 HANA Commodity Trading and Risk Management Process Lead

DKI Jakarta Full time

MAIN DUTIES AND RESPONSIBILITIES

1. Requirement Elicitation and Analysis

  • Business Requirement Definition: Leads workshops with Traders, Trade Controllers and Trade Operations to extract and document detailed business requirements (BRDs).
  • Logic Translation: Translates complex commercial and operations logic—including pricing formulas, stock valuation, and optionality etc —into clear, unambiguous functional requirements for the SAP technical team.
  • Sustainability & Traceability (Palm Oil): Define and validate requirements for EUDR (European Union Deforestation Regulation) compliance and RSPO (Roundtable on Sustainable Palm Oil) certification within the SAP ACM solution. Ensure that critical sustainability attributes are captured as purchase/sale contract requirements and accurately flow through logistics execution via batch characteristics to maintain the chain of custody.
  • Gap Analysis: Conducts detailed analysis of the "As-Is" trading processes versus the "To-Be" SAP standard capabilities, identifying critical gaps where business processes must adapt or where system enhancement is required for financial compliance or operations continuity.

2. Functional Design Validation

  • Solution Verification: Reviews functional design documents provided by SAP ACM, SD, and FICO consultants to ensure they satisfy the core business requirements.
  • Logistics & Execution Integration: Validates the design of Nominations and Delivery Execution processes to safeguard the integration integrity between SAP ACM and SAP Transportation Management (TM).
  • Calculation Validation: Independently verifies the accuracy of critical system algorithms, including Mark-to-Market (MTM) valuations, Unrealized/Realized PnL attribution, and FX exposure calculations, ensuring they align with approved financial models.
  • Design Authority: Serves as the gatekeeper for functional design approval, rejecting technical proposals that fail to account for specific trading nuances (e.g., washouts, circles, basis risk).

3. Quality Assurance and Testing

  • Scenario Definition: Develops comprehensive "Real Life" test scenarios that cover the full trade lifecycle, including edge cases such as contract amendments, quality claims, complex settlement logic, traceability failures.
  • UAT Orchestration: Coordinates and manages the User Acceptance Testing (UAT) phase for the commercial track, defining acceptance criteria and ensuring business users execute tests rigorously.
  • Defect Triage: Analyzes functional defects reported during testing, distinguishing between system errors and user data issues, and articulates the necessary fixes to the development team.

4. Process Modelling and Implementation Support

  • Process Mapping: Develops detailed process flow diagrams covering Deal Capture, Nominations, Risk Management, Logistics Execution, and Financial Settlement.
  • Change Facilitation: Supports the organizational change management effort by articulating the impact of the new system on daily trading operations and assisting in the preparation of standard operating procedures (SOPs).
  • Data Validation: Defines validation rules for the migration of open contracts and historical trade data, ensuring financial integrity during the cutover from legacy systems.